Common Causes of Bluescreen Errors

Let's play detective and find out what usually causes these bluescreen errors in Windows 11.

Outdated Drivers

Drivers are like instructions that help your computer parts talk to each other. Old instructions sometimes have mistakes. Imagine following old directions to a new place – you might get lost!

Software Glitches

Even the programs on your computer sometimes get confused and need help. It's like when you're trying to play a game, and it suddenly freezes – the computer just needs a little break to get back on track!

Fixing Bluescreen Errors: A Step-by-Step Guide

Alright, let's roll up our sleeves and learn how to fix these bluescreen errors, step by step.

Restart Your Computer

Sometimes the easiest solution is just to start over – let's try turning your computer off and on again.

Step Description
1 Check for updates - Make sure your Windows 11 is up to date with the latest patches and updates. Sometimes, a simple update can fix blue screen errors.
2 Run Windows Memory Diagnostic - Use the built-in tool to check for memory issues that may be causing the blue screen errors.
3 Uninstall recently installed software - If you recently installed new software, try uninstalling it to see if it resolves the blue screen errors.
4 Update device drivers - Outdated or incompatible drivers can often cause blue screen errors. Update your drivers to the latest version.
5 Check for hardware issues - If none of the above steps work, it may be worth checking for hardware problems that could be causing the blue screen errors.
